Water opossum, ( Chironectes minimus ), also called yapok or yapock, a semiaquatic, web-footed marsupial (family Didelphidae, subfamily Didelphinae) found along tropical rivers, streams, and lakes from Mexico to Argentina. Water opos­sums are most often found in semi-aquatic or aquatic habi­tats, par­tic­u­larly in fresh­wa­ter streams and near-shore lakes as­so­ci­ated with trop­i­cal or sub­trop­i­cal forests.
